Hi guys,

My car engine is having high engine oil lost, around 1 litres for 1500km. When stationary revving can see smoke come out from tailpipe (4-5k rpm). No smoke come out during normal startup every morning. Engine sounds normal. Compression in all cylinders are 155, 150, 155, 150. Leakdown test shows no leakage. Engine sounds normal no tak tak tak sound. Recent dyno shows 160whp (factory rated 204hp). Engine history unknown as i just bought this car.
I suspect maybe the third piston ring (the one that swips down the engine oil) is worn...or jam? Do i need to do an overhaul? If yes, how much usually? Budget 3k enough?

Engine : sr20ve 20v neo vvl
Engine oil used : shell fs 5w40

I was thinking, just change all the gaskets and seals and change the piston rings and bottom end bearing. No rebore and reuse pistons. If that is possible...how much would this usually costs?
Then need to open up and inspect the cylinder wall. If still okay, then ring change will do, but if cylinder wall not good, then need rebore......

I was thinking, just change all the gaskets and seals and change the piston rings and bottom end bearing. No rebore and reuse pistons. If that is possible...how much would this usually costs?
cost is subjective and heavily dependent on your mech. Best you ask mechs for quotations.

And yes - what you're talking about is a normal overhaul. Rebore and changing pistons usually is done only when needed and if needed, you have serious issues
